Output 9489ad8e95ae2dff1068676199df720567ebcbbb9c905ee992c6ce26d17e336a:8

value
21887160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8062a9bffb568f77cf4242d222493cdfba3d3ab2 OP_EQUAL
address
MKbzvDUPHuVhwXhbrCSRqDAqXZkAkUTAzr
transaction
9489ad8e95ae2dff1068676199df720567ebcbbb9c905ee992c6ce26d17e336a
spent
true